Mount Vigiljoch. 
Surrounded by clarity.

To preserve this picturesque natural idyll, the Vigiljoch can only be reached by cable car. It is a place of enriching seclusion that has been highly sought after as a place of recreation since 1912, when the Vigiljoch cable car first opened. After the old mountain hotel fell into disrepair, the vigilius mountain resort integrated itself into the landscape with architectural care and ecological awareness in order to enter into a sustainable symbiosis with it. Respect for nature and the cultural heritage here can be felt in every aspect. 

Sights in Merano and the surrounding area

Take in the view of the UNESCO World Heritage Site, the Dolomites, from the vigilius mountain resort. The most beautiful mountains in South Tyrol are about 90 minutes away by car. The nearby Ultental also presents itself in its originality with its own unique charm. It is always an experience due to its impressive nature, culturally interesting farms, and famous ancient larch trees.

In Bolzano and Merano, you can enjoy various delicacies and discover traditional craftsmanship in the historic arcades, narrow alleys, and spacious squares, depending on the season. A leisurely stroll can be taken along the “Waale,” which have been irrigating the low-rainfall Alpine valleys since the time of Maria Theresa, turning into a network of kilometers-long paths.

Music

Sound meets scenery at the grand selection of international cultural festivals: the South Tyrol Jazz Festival, Merano Music Weeks, Merano Jazz Festival and Lana Live.

Museums

Enjoy history, modernity, and always a unique perspective, at the region’s many museums. Explore the Touriseum museum in the blooming gardens of Trauttmansdorff Castle in Merano, the Ötzi Museum in Bolzano, the Andreas Hofer Museum in Val Passiria, the Messner Mountain Museums by the South Tyrolean alpinist legend Reinhold Messner, and so many more.

Culture and Events

Discover well-visited events such as the Bolzano Dance Summer, the South Tyrol Classic Car Rally and the atmospheric nights in the gardens of Trauttmansdorff Castle.

Wine

The oldest wine-growing region in the German-speaking world boasts exquisite premium wines and traditional wineries. Experience events such as the Merano Wine Festival and the Vernatsch Cup, held at vigilius mountain resort, visited by wine lovers of Italy and the world.

Bocce

At vigilius we have rediscovered the game of bocce (“Boccia” in Italian). Do you play bocce? Thanks to the original bocce court of the old mountain hotel, which has been lovingly restored, it is possible to play bocce at the vigilius. Bocce is the Italian variant of lawn bowling; the goal is to place your own balls as close as possible to a smaller target ball (pallino) or to shoot the opponent’s balls away from the pallino. Bocce means togetherness, movement, and competition with a lot of fun.
